KARACHI: Sindh Chief Minister Syed Murad Ali Shah and Senior Minister Sharjeel Inam Memon on Monday separately called on Pakistan Peoples Party Chairman Bilawal Bhutto-Zardari.

A statement said that the CM briefed the party chairman on overall administrative and political situation of the province.

In his meeting with Mr Bhutto-Zardari, Mr Memon briefed him on ongoing transport projects in Sindh, including initiatives aimed at improving public transportation facilities.

He also provided an update on the performance and ongoing strategies of the Sindh government’s information department.
